Houston Repertoire Ballet presents "Rodeo", performed by Houston area high school students! This exciting cowboy themed story-ballet, set to the fantastic music of Aaron Copland, tells a tale of the American Old West and the ranch's first cowgirl. Audiences will also get a taste of classical ballet with an excerpt number from "Sleeping Beauty"!

This FREE Art Camp is a program in partnership with the Museum of Fine Arts Houston (MFAH). Teachers from the prestigious MFAH Glassell school for the Arts come in to teach kids ages 7-12 art classes (10am – 12pm) for four days in the selected week (Mon-Thurs) culminating in a free field trip on Friday (bus provided) to the museum!
MFAH Art Camp at LSC-Tomball Community Library will take place from Monday, July 27 to Friday, July 31.
